The role of the case manager is transitioning. An increase in patient complexity, changes in regulatory compliance, and challenges of the unfunded and underfunded patient--all impact the case manager’s ability to coordinate care in a timely manner with optimal outcomes. This session will address the challenges of both the case manager and the case management leader in the evolution of hospital case management. This session will also provide updates on issues of concern, including discharge planning and readmissions, keeping your case management department compliant, monitoring your case management outcomes, and using data to support process improvement.  


Objectives:
  1. Develop strategies for case management practice.
  2. Establish optimal outcomes management monitoring using case management “report cards.”
  3. Identify upcoming challenges facing case managers and case management leaders.
